One hundred kilometres is the first real exam in Drill to Earth’s Core. Grass through Void is a fuel, wall, and structure test, not a speedrun trophy. Thirty players share one drill. If the tank hits zero in Clay or the 100,000 HP Abyss wall meets a team that bought Drive Speed and nothing else, the run ends short of Glowing Core. This page is the layer-by-layer plan. Bring the habits from the first-hour guide: Miner or a depth class, sacks, coal, and Drill Power ranks already purchased. Do not start a 100 KM attempt on a brand-new account that still thinks Cores buy fuel.
Grass through Stone (0-17 km)
Grass runs 0-3,000 m with 100 HP walls. Dirt is 3,000-10,000 m with 500 HP walls. Stone is 10,000-17,000 m with 1,000 HP walls. Ordinary walls still spawn about every 700 m to 1 km, so the bit is never “done” just because you broke the layer boss. The first dungeon is guaranteed at 3,000 m; take it. Dirt then rolls Spider Tunnel and Mineshaft. Clear Mineshaft. Spider’s Den (the Dirt spider tunnel) is skippable if the lobby is disorganized, the drill is already taking chip damage, or nobody brought a gun. A clean four-player clear is worth the chests. A 20-person wipe on webs is how 100 KM attempts die before Clay. More structure notes sit in dungeons and structures.
Upgrade order for this stretch: Drill Power until walls break without a 30-second stall, Fuel Storage so the tank survives idle mining, Sack Storage so ore actually reaches the Trading Post, then Drill Defense. Common upgrades start at 100 coins and rise after each buy in that rarity. Rare ranks (Power Slam, Engine Overdrive, Mega Drill, Firepower, Sharpness, Blast Power) start at 250. Skip stacking Power Drive. It moves the chassis; it does not kill walls. Full buy advice is on the upgrade tier list. Trading Posts are mandatory pit stops. Sell, refill, and leave. Gold bars from the furnace (about 500 coins each) are why crafting matters before Fossil.
Clay through Crystal (17-41 km)
Clay is 17,000-24,000 m with 2,000 HP walls. Void Clay in this layer empties the fuel tank on contact. Treat orange-black clay patches like lava. Assign two miners to coal at all times. If the tank blips, stop the drill and recover; a dry chassis in Clay is a wipe. Vampire Mansion spawns here and drops Golden Keys. Run it when the team is healthy. Skip it when fuel is already a problem. Churches appear about every 300 km, so you will not stash tools yet, but you should still think like someone who can lose the server: do not leave unique drops sitting in a sack you will drop on death.
Fossil is 24,000-31,000 m with 4,000 HP walls. Crystal is 31,000-41,000 m with 10,000 HP walls. This is where Bombo and Fuel Leeches start. Bombo explodes and disables crafted items for one minute; put turrets and scanners away from the blast and do not panic-pop a Drill Boost during the disable window. Fuel Leeches are why Fuel Storage ranks from earlier pay rent. Goblin Arena and Spider’s Lair both live in Crystal. Arena is a loot stop if the lobby can shoot. Spider’s Lair is a skip if you already skipped Spider’s Den for time; two spider wipes in one run is how 100 KM becomes 40 KM.
Buy Power Burst (Epic, 500 coins to start) before you leave Crystal if the lobby can afford it. Power Burst is the button you hold for late walls and for the 100 km fight. Deadly Drill is a later Common; it helps once walls are already breaking, not as a substitute for Drill Power. Mega Drill and Power Slam are cheaper if someone bought Driller. Life Steal (Epic) and Health Regen (Legendary, 1,000) are comfort, not a skip button. RPM Overclock is the Robux-leaning Epic; F2P teams should keep pouring coins into Drill Power and Fuel Storage instead.
Toxic through Glowing Core (41-100 km)
Toxic 41,000-51,000 m (25,000 HP), Radioactive 51,000-61,000 m (50,000 HP), Abyss 61,000-72,000 m (100,000 HP), Void 72,000-84,000 m (200,000 HP), then Glowing Core from 84,000 m with the 100 km boss wall at 500,000 HP. Heart of Earth at 1,000,000 m with a 5,000,000 HP wall is a different expedition; do not plan it on this run. Boss walls spawn two cave flanks plus a fight behind the drill. After the 15 August patch, teleporters are disabled during boss walls, so you cannot blink out of a bad flank. Natural regen is 1 HP per 12 seconds. That is background, not a medic.
Park at every Trading Post. Restock $100 medkits and 60-second speed potions as soon as they appear. Craft Basic Drill Boost (300 scrap, 10,000 m launch) before 90 km if the lobby might skip the core wall; Void Drill Boost (1,000 scrap, 50,000 m) is overkill for a first 100 KM and better as a later skip tool. Cart Extension at 10,000 coins is Mythic flex, not a requirement. Ultra Drill and Money Drill (Legendary) help if the coin pile is real; they are not why you failed at 70 km. You failed at 70 km because fuel, Defense, or a skipped Trading Post died in Clay.
From 84 km, play like the wall is already up. Rebuild barricades, assign cave teams, and read the core boss checklist out loud. A team that reaches 99 km with Power Burst, six medkits, and a moving drill is a 100 KM team. A team that reaches 99 km with empty sacks and a dry tank is a highlight reel for the next lobby.

How long does a 100 KM run take?
A coordinated 30-player lobby with Drill Power ranks and fuel discipline can do it in one sitting. Disorganized public servers often die in Clay or Crystal and need a second attempt.
When should I skip Spider's Den?
Skip the Dirt spider tunnel if the drill is already taking chip damage, the lobby has no guns, or a wipe would burn the fuel you need for Clay. Mineshaft is usually still worth clearing.
Why did our fuel vanish in Clay?
Void Clay empties the tank on contact. Fuel Leeches from Crystal onward also drain. Rank Fuel Storage, keep miners on coal, and stop the chassis instead of driving through the bad patch.
Which upgrade matters most for depth?
Drill Power first. Then Fuel Storage and Sack Storage. Buy Power Burst before the late walls. Avoid over-investing Power Drive. Driller makes several drill ranks cheaper.
Can I skip the 100 km wall?
Yes. Basic Drill Boost (300 scrap) launches 10,000 m and can skip the core wall. Fighting it pays a Void Crystal and is covered on the core boss page.
